17 Backrest
17.1 Angle adjustment of the backrest
For adjusting the angle of the backrest, open
the clamp lever by turning counter-clockwise (a
half to a complete rotation). Then the backrest
can be moved forwards of backwards. The
length of the backrest support changes during
the movement of the backrest.
Once the desired angle of the backrest is set,
hold the backrest in this position and then
close the clamp lever again clockwise with a
half to complete rotation.
Figure 32: Angle adjustment of the backrest via the
clamp lever
If the clamp lever rests on the frame of the
product when turning, you have the option of
pulling the clamp lever out vertically to the
rotating axis and to let go into another angled
position via the integrated serration, and keep
on turning.
Figure 33: Put the clamp lever in another angled
position by pulling out
After every adjustment, check that the
backrest is firmly attached in its position.
